Output 39e3f3308fef84d26637c8eb26c004ec024851d6e3edd839da3d567cfa51f771:0

value
31373460
script pubkey
OP_0 OP_PUSHBYTES_20 64166f63e7829d155bea8df75da3bc42abeef7d8
address
ltc1qvstx7cl8s2w32kl23hm4mgaug247aa7c4xw8y5
transaction
39e3f3308fef84d26637c8eb26c004ec024851d6e3edd839da3d567cfa51f771
spent
true